BUILDING ROBUST DATA PIPELINES FOR MACHINE LEARNING

Building Robust Data Pipelines for Machine Learning

Building Robust Data Pipelines for Machine Learning

Blog Article

In the realm of machine learning, a robust data pipeline stands as the bedrock upon which successful models are constructed. These pipelines orchestrate the seamless gathering and manipulation of data, ensuring its quality and suitability for training algorithms. A well-designed pipeline comprises multiple stages, each performing a specific function. Data sources can range from databases and APIs to real-time feeds. As data flows through the pipeline, it undergoes cleansing to remove inaccuracies. Subsequently, features are extracted to create a format readily comprehensible by machine learning techniques. A robust pipeline also incorporates mechanisms for tracking data quality and detecting potential issues in real time. By enhancing the data flow, a robust pipeline empowers machine learning practitioners to train high-performing models with increased precision.

The Powerhouse of Analytics

Data engineering forms the foundation of modern analytics. It's the critical process of gathering raw data from various sources, cleaning it into a usable format, and storing it in a way that allows for efficient interpretation. Data engineers are the unsung heroes who ensure that data is reliable, available when needed, and organized for maximum insight. Without their expertise, the vast potential of data remains untapped.

Designing Scalable and Reliable Data Infrastructures

In today's data-driven world, organizations are increasingly depending on robust and scalable data infrastructures to support their operations. Building a data infrastructure that can handle ever-growing data volumes, ensure high availability, and maintain reliability is crucial for success. A well-designed data infrastructure should encompass various components such as storage systems, processing engines, analytics tools, and security measures.

By implementing best practices in architecture design, automation, and monitoring, organizations can create data infrastructures that are both resilient and sustainable.

  • A key aspect of designing scalable data infrastructures is to choose appropriate technologies that can scale horizontally. Cloud computing platforms offer a dynamic environment for deploying and scaling data infrastructure components on demand.
  • Abstraction layers techniques can help organizations integrate disparate data sources into a unified view, enhancing data accessibility and insights.
  • Implementing robust monitoring and logging practices is essential for ensuring the reliability of data infrastructures. Real-time dashboards and alerts can provide valuable insights into system performance and potential issues.

Harnessing the Data Beast: Mastering Data Ingestion and Transformation

In today's data-driven world, organizations are inundated with an ever-growing volume of information. Effectively leveraging this deluge requires a robust strategy for data ingestion and transformation. Data ingestion encompasses the process of gathering raw data from diverse sources, such as databases, APIs, and data pipelines. Once ingested, data must be cleaned into a format that is meaningful for analysis and decision-making. This often involves processes like data validation, concatenation, and formatting.

  • Automating these processes is crucial for ensuring data quality, consistency, and efficiency.
  • By successfully controlling the data beast, organizations can unlock valuable insights, drive innovation, and gain a competitive edge.

Unlocking Insights: Data Engineering for Business Intelligence

In today's data-driven world, organizations rely heavily on robust insights to make strategic decisions. This is where data engineering plays a pivotal role. Data engineers act as the builders of data pipelines, transforming raw data into interpretable information that fuels analytics initiatives. By streamlining data processes, they enable stakeholders to discover hidden trends, forecast future outcomes, and ultimately drive growth.

  • Leveraging modern data technologies such as cloud computing and big data platforms is critical for effective data engineering.
  • Communication between data engineers and business users is crucial to ensure that data meets the specific requirements of the company.
  • Data governance and security are paramount considerations in data engineering, as they protect sensitive information and guarantee compliance with regulations.

Enhancing Data Flow: Real-Time Data Engineering Solutions

In today's fast-paced business environment, organizations rely on real-time data to make agile decisions. Achieving this requires robust data engineering solutions that can seamlessly handle the magnitude of incoming data and transform it into relevant insights in real time.

This involves a range of methodologies such as pipeline orchestration to ensure data get more info integrity. ,Moreover, these solutions often utilize serverless architectures to scale to the ever-growing requirements of modern businesses.

By implementing real-time data engineering solutions, organizations can gain a competitive advantage by:

* Enhancing operational efficiency

* Supporting faster decision-making

* Promoting innovation

Real-time data engineering is no longer just a luxury, it's a imperative for organizations that want to prosper in the digital age.

Report this page